Unit 1

Quiz yourself by thinking what should be in each of the black spaces below before clicking on it to display the answer.
        Help!  

Term
Definition
Precision   The quality of being exact  
🗑
Accuracy   The ability to work without mistakes  
🗑
Scientific Notation   Method that expresses the number multiplied by 10 and the appropriate power  
🗑
Percent Error   Experimental value minus the accepted value, divided by the accepted value and then multiplied by 100  
🗑
Quantitative Data   Numerical measurements rather than its words  
🗑
Qualitative Data   Data in words rather than in numbers  
🗑
Precipitate   a solid that is produced by a chemical reaction in solution  
🗑
Specific Heat   the heat required to raise the temperature of the mass of a given substance by given amount  
🗑
Atom   smallest particle of a substance that can exist by itself  
🗑
Electron Cloud   system of electrons surrounding the nucleus of an atom  
🗑
Mass Number   sum of the protons and neutrons in the nucleus of an atom  
🗑
Metalloid   element with the properties of both metals and nonmetals  
🗑
Density   mass per unit of volume  
🗑
Significant Figure   the figure of a number that express a magnitude to a specified degree of accuracy  
🗑
Isotope   atoms with same number of protons but not the same nunber of neutrons  
🗑
Nuclear Fusion   reaction in which the nuclei of one atom combines with the nuclei of another to form a larger nuclei  
🗑
Atomic Number   Number of protons in the nucleus in an atom  
🗑
Noble Gas   Group 18 in the periodic table with a full outer shell  
🗑
Chemistry   A science that deals with the structure and properties
